Oakland, CA (June 10, 2026) – A multi-vehicle collision was reported early on Tuesday morning, June 9, on eastbound Interstate 580 near the 35th Avenue off-ramp. The wreck was first reported around 5:08 a.m.
At least three vehicles were involved, including a gray Lexus sedan and a white Ford Explorer; the Lexus came to rest on its roof, blocking middle lanes of the freeway, and the Ford Explorer sustained major damage and was also disabled on the roadway.
One person was taken to Highland Hospital with unknown injuries, and a person in a Honda HR-V was also noted as having been helped out of their vehicle at the scene. It was not immediately clear how many others were in the vehicles at the time of the collision.
Tow trucks were called to clear the damaged vehicles, and the roadway remained partially blocked during the cleanup. No further details about those involved in the accident were available at the time of this report. The cause of the crash is still being determined by investigators.

What Typically Happens After a Multi-Vehicle Rollover on a California Freeway?
Rollovers on freeways can result in lane closures that can last several hours, depending on how many vehicles are involved and how they came to rest on the road. Emergency units typically work to secure the area, assist anyone still in the vehicles, and begin clearing debris as quickly as possible. Tow companies are dispatched based on rotation lists managed by highway patrol.
When multiple vehicles are involved in a single freeway crash, investigators piece together the sequence of events using physical evidence, vehicle positions, and any available camera or phone data. iPhone crash notifications, which can alert emergency services automatically, have become a more common source of early information in these cases. That data can help establish a timeline before witness accounts are gathered.
Injuries from rollover crashes can vary widely, even among people in the same vehicle. The presence or absence of airbag deployment, seatbelt use, and where a person was seated can all affect outcomes.
